Technical Overview

Why Kovar is Essential for CT Tubes

Computed Tomography (CT) scanners rely on high-performance X-ray tubes that operate under extreme conditions. These tubes generate significant heat while requiring precise alignment and hermetic sealing to maintain performance and safety.

Kovar (ASTM F-15) has emerged as the material of choice for critical CT tube components due to its unique combination of thermal expansion properties, mechanical strength, and compatibility with glass-to-metal sealing processes.

Key Insight

The thermal expansion coefficient of Kovar (3.3 x 10⁻⁶/°C) closely matches that of borosilicate glass, enabling the creation of reliable hermetic seals critical for maintaining vacuum conditions within CT tubes.

Thermal Stability

Maintains dimensional stability under extreme temperature fluctuations (up to 300°C) experienced in CT tube operation.

Hermetic Sealing

Enables perfect glass-to-metal seals that maintain vacuum integrity essential for X-ray generation in CT tubes.

Mechanical Strength

Withstands operational stresses and vibrations while maintaining critical dimensional tolerances.

Extended Lifespan

Reduces component failure rates, extending CT tube service life and reducing maintenance costs.

Component Applications

Kovar Components in CT Tubes

Kovar is utilized in several critical components within CT scanner tubes, where its unique properties deliver essential performance benefits.

X-ray Tube Envelopes

Kovar forms the metal portions of the evacuated envelope, creating a hermetic seal with glass sections while maintaining dimensional stability during thermal cycling.

Electrode Assemblies

Kovar electrodes maintain precise positioning despite temperature variations, ensuring consistent electron beam alignment and X-ray production.

Cooling System Interfaces

Kovar components provide reliable connections between the tube’s vacuum chamber and external cooling systems, withstanding both thermal and mechanical stresses.

Positioning Mechanisms

Precision-machined Kovar parts maintain critical alignment of rotating anodes and other moving components, ensuring image quality and equipment safety.
